> Here, you write the backups twice if the user's option is add  
> backup-support(since we have already written once in  
> update_backup_super). And the old solution will remove backup flag if  
> the backup update fails(see below), but now I am not sure whether it is  
> appropriate.

	Yeah, I decided that writing the backups twice is fine,
certainly better than the complexity of trying to avoid it.
	Sunil and I discussed removing the flag.  I think we want to
keep it - it's a hint to any following program that it should try to
recreate them.  Otherwise we've just disabled the feature.  Plus, if the
backups failed, the old backups are still good, just out of date.  Which
is better than having no backups at all.
